Summary:"In his first collection of short stories, acclaimed author Niq Mhlongo confronts the span of ... [South Africa's] democracy and the madness of the last twenty years after apartheid. He takes an unflinching look at urban and rural South Africa, which he explores through themes such as racism, xenophobia, homophobia, crime, land distribution and economic inequality. Stylistically satirical and piercing, the stories combine Mhlongo's street-smart realism with a truly South African magical realism" -- Back cover
